Free re-usable period products now available to order

West Lothian Council is making free re-usable period products available for local residents.

A wide-range of free single-use period products have been available for a number of years, from venues including schools, sports centres, and other community locations such as food larders.

To enhance this service, West Lothian residents can now order up to three free re-usable products, which can then be collected from any of West Lothian's nine partnerships centres spread across the area or West Lothian Civic Centre in Livingston.

To launch the new service, Executive councillor for the economy, community empowerment and wealth building Kirsteen Sullivan visited Blackburn Community Food Larder in Blackburn Partnership Centre to see the range of free period products available. 

Councillor Kirsteen Sullivan said: "I'm delighted than we are now able to add re-usable period products to the single-use products that are already widely available in West Lothian.

"Many woman and girls now prefer re-usable products for environmental or comfort reasons, so it's great to be able to provide this option for them. 

"They are all completely free to anyone in West Lothian without any eligibility criteria, so I would urge anyone who needs them to put an order in."

Ring-fenced funding to ensure a wide range of period products are free and easy to obtain for all resident who require them is provided to local authorities by the Scottish Government, under the Free Period Product Provision Act (2021).
